include/asm/ptrace.h userspace headers cleanup
This patch contains the following cleanups for the asm/ptrace.h
userspace headers:
- include/asm-generic/Kbuild.asm already lists ptrace.h, remove
the superfluous listings in the Kbuild files of the following
architectures:
- cris
- frv
- powerpc
- x86
- don't expose function prototypes and macros to userspace:
- arm
- blackfin
- cris
- mn10300
- parisc
- remove #ifdef CONFIG_'s around #define's:
- blackfin
- m68knommu
- sh: AFAIK __SH5__ should work in both kernel and userspace,
no need to leak CONFIG_SUPERH64 to userspace
- xtensa: cosmetical change to remove empty
#ifndef __ASSEMBLY__ #else #endif
from the userspace headers
Not changed by this patch is the fact that the following architectures
have a different struct pt_regs depending on CONFIG_ variables:
- h8300
- m68knommu
- mips
This does not work in userspace.
